Sherpur: A mobile court in a drive fined two fertilizer traders Taka 1 lakh 20 thousand for selling fertilizer at higher prices than the government's fixed rates and selling without a license. The mobile court of Sadar upazila administration conducted a drive in Akher Mahmud Bazar area around 1 pm and fined Meem Enterprise Taka 1 lakh for selling fertilizer above the government-fixed price at Akher Mahmud Bazar in Sadar upazila, and Shishir Enterprise Taka 20,000 for selling fertilizer without a license.

According to Bangladesh Sangbad Sangstha, Sadar Upazila Nirbahi Officer and Executive Magistrate Md. Abdullah Al Mahmud Bhuiyan led the mobile court. Sadar Upazila Agriculture Officer Muslima Khanam Nilu and Extension Officer Md. Anwar Hossain, along with Ansar members, were present at the time.

Sadar Upazila Agriculture Officer Muslima Khanam Nilu stated that the Agriculture Department is actively working in the field to dismantle the fertilizer syndicate as part of its regular activities. The drive is being conducted to protect the interests of farmers in this regard.
